Diabetes: Does screening for inducible ischemia improve outcomes?
Nature Reviews. Cardiology
|June 26, 2009
Summary
Screening for inducible myocardial ischemia did not improve clinical outcomes in asymptomatic type 2 diabetes patients. Future research should explore targeted interventions for high-risk individuals based on atherosclerotic burden.
Area of Science:
- Cardiology
- Diabetology
- Preventive Medicine
Background:
- The DIAD trial assessed the impact of screening for inducible myocardial ischemia in asymptomatic type 2 diabetes patients.
- Most participants had well-controlled diabetes and received optimal medical management.
- Few patients in the study underwent revascularization procedures.
Discussion:
- Routine screening for myocardial ischemia did not enhance clinical outcomes in this cohort.
- The study population's excellent medical management may have influenced the results.
- A low rate of revascularization suggests a conservative approach to invasive procedures.
Key Insights:
- Screening for inducible myocardial ischemia offers no discernible benefit for asymptomatic type 2 diabetes patients.
- Current medical management strategies for type 2 diabetes may mitigate the need for routine ischemia screening.
- Individualized risk assessment is crucial for guiding treatment decisions.
Outlook:
- Future studies should investigate the cost-effectiveness of unconditional treatment versus risk-stratified screening.
- Evaluating therapeutic interventions alongside risk-factor management and selective revascularization is recommended.
- Identifying high-risk patients for targeted interventions remains a key objective.

Type II Diabetes Mellitus III: Clinical Manifestations and Diagnosis
Type 2 diabetes mellitus develops gradually and is often asymptomatic in early stages.Clinical ManifestationsWhen symptoms appear, they include fatigue, blurred vision, pruritus, delayed wound healing, and recurrent infections, particularly candidal infections. Peripheral neuropathy may present as numbness or tingling in the extremities. Classic hyperglycemia symptoms—polyuria, polydipsia, and polyphagia—are less common. Diabetes Mellitus: Type 2 and Gestational
Type 2 diabetes, characterized by insulin resistance, arises when the insulin receptors on cells lose responsiveness to insulin, diminishing the cell's capacity to take up glucose, resulting in elevated blood glucose levels. To receive a diagnosis of Type 2 diabetes, a series of blood glucose tests are necessary to assess whether the blood glucose falls within normal parameters. Diabetes: Symptoms, Diagnosis, and Complications
For most patients, experiencing several weeks of polyuria, polydipsia, fatigue, and significant weight loss may indicate the presence of diabetes. Furthermore, adults displaying the phenotypic appearance of type 2 diabetes (particularly those who are obese and not initially insulin-requiring), may have islet cell autoantibodies, suggesting autoimmune-mediated β cell destruction and a diagnosis of latent autoimmune diabetes of adults (LADA). Complications of Diabetes Mellitus
Diabetes mellitus is a chronic metabolic disorder characterized by persistent hyperglycemia due to insulin deficiency, resistance, or both. Prolonged hyperglycemia disrupts metabolic homeostasis and leads to acute and chronic complications.Acute ComplicationsAcute complications result from sudden metabolic imbalance.Diabetic ketoacidosis (DKA) mainly appears in type 1 diabetes but may also develop in type 2 diabetes, particularly under extreme stress.
